2012-04-23 13 views
16

क्यों symfony 2 deps फ़ाइल और composer.json फ़ाइल दोनों का उपयोग करता है?क्यों symfony 2 'deps' फ़ाइल और 'composer.json' फ़ाइल दोनों का उपयोग करता है?

मैं देख सकता हूँ कुछ दस्तावेजों को मुझे बताओ: अन्य जबकि

php bin/vendors install 

मेरे लिए बता:

php composer.phar install 

उत्तर

15

deps फ़ाइल और bin/vendors स्क्रिप्ट Symfony 2.0.x में उपयोग किया जाता है, जबकि Symfony 2.1.x संगीतकार को स्विच कर दिया गया है। bin/vendors स्क्रिप्ट सिर्फ एक स्टब था क्योंकि संगीतकार उत्पादन के लिए तैयार नहीं था जब सिम्फनी 2.0.0 जारी किया गया था।

+0

'बिन/विक्रेताओं 'में कार्यक्षमता प्रतीत होती है कि संगीतकार (और उम्मीद नहीं की जानी चाहिए), जैसे विक्रेता बंडलों से' वेब/बंडल 'तक संपत्तियों की प्रतिलिपि बनाना। – Tgr

+0

इसके लिए 'संपत्ति: इंस्टॉल' कमांड है और 'बिन/विक्रेता' बस इसे अपने रन के अंत में कॉल करता है। –

+1

बिंदु यह है कि 'php composer.phar install' इसे कॉल नहीं करता है। इसलिए जब तक आप वास्तव में नहीं जानते कि आप क्या कर रहे हैं, तो आप 'बिन/विक्रेता' का उपयोग करना बेहतर कर सकते हैं, जो संगीतकार को वैसे भी कॉल करेगा, लेकिन अन्य उपयोगी सामान भी हो सकता है। – Tgr

संबंधित मुद्दे